What a Chimney Sweep Does for Your Home in Ashville

A chimney sweep is the mechanical removal of creosote, soot, and debris from the chimney flue using correctly sized professional brushes matched to your specific flue dimensions and liner type in Ashville, OH. The sweep covers the full flue length from the chimney top to the firebox, the smoke chamber and smoke shelf, and the accessible firebox interior in Ashville. All displaced material is captured using HEPA vacuum equipment so none of it redistributes into your living space in Ashville, OH.

Beyond the cleaning itself, a chimney sweep from Chimney Master includes a basic visual inspection of your accessible chimney components in Ashville. If we see anything that warrants attention, we tell you clearly before we leave in Ashville, OH.

Creosote Buildup and Chimney Fire Risk in Ashville, OH

Creosote is the combustible byproduct of wood combustion that deposits on flue walls as combustion gases cool against the cooler flue surfaces in Ashville. In its early stage it is a light, flaky soot that standard brushing removes easily in Ashville, OH. Left unaddressed, it progresses to a harder, tarrier deposit and eventually to a glazed, dense coating that bonds to the flue surface and burns at temperatures exceeding 2,000 degrees Fahrenheit in Ashville. A chimney fire from ignited creosote can damage or destroy the liner, cause structural damage to the chimney, and in serious cases spread to the surrounding home structure in Ashville, OH. Annual sweeping removes creosote at the manageable stage one level before it ever reaches the dangerous stages in Ashville.

Carbon Monoxide and Poor Draft Problems in Ashville, OH

A partially blocked chimney flue from creosote accumulation, debris, or animal nesting does not just reduce draft performance in Ashville. It can cause combustion gases including carbon monoxide to back up into the home rather than being exhausted through the flue in Ashville, OH. Carbon monoxide is colorless and odorless. It produces symptoms including headache, dizziness, and nausea that are frequently mistaken for other illnesses in Ashville. A clean, unobstructed flue is a basic requirement for safe fireplace operation in Ashville, OH.

Chimney Types Chimney Master Sweeps and Cleans in Ashville, OH

Wood-Burning Fireplace Sweep in Ashville

Primary creosote producers. Swept across all configurations in Ashville, OH — standard open fireplaces, raised-hearth designs, corner fireplaces, and double-sided fireplaces in Ashville.

Gas Fireplace Sweep and Cleaning in Ashville, OH

Gas fireplaces produce less creosote but still require periodic inspection and cleaning in Ashville. Gas combustion produces water vapor and combustion byproducts that accumulate on flue surfaces over time in Ashville, OH.

Wood Stove and Insert Sweep in Ashville

High creosote producers at low operating temperatures. Sweep includes the stove pipe connector between the appliance and the chimney wall — a significant accumulation point in Ashville, OH.

Oil Furnace Flue Cleaning in Ashville, OH

Accumulate acidic soot and combustion deposits corrosive to metal liner components. Cleaned with appropriate equipment for the specific deposits oil combustion produces in Ashville.

Prefabricated Chimney Sweep in Ashville

Metal flue systems requiring brushes sized for the specific flue diameter. Swept across all major brands with specific attention to metal component inspection in Ashville, OH.

Chimney Sweep and Cleaning Cost in Ashville, OH

Chimney sweep and cleaning costs in Ashville, OH vary based on chimney type and the level of accumulation present. All pricing confirmed upfront before any work begins in Ashville.

Standard wood-burning fireplace sweep — full flue, smoke chamber and shelf, firebox, damper, and basic inspection in Ashville$150–$300
Gas fireplace sweep and cleaning — flue inspection and cleaning, firebox interior, basic inspection in Ashville, OH$100–$200
Wood stove or insert sweep — including stove pipe connector and full liner in Ashville$150–$300
Oil furnace flue cleaning — full flue brushing and acidic deposit removal in Ashville, OH$150–$275
Heavy creosote or extended service — stage two or three accumulation requiring additional equipment and time in Ashville$300–$600+

What Affects the Price in Ashville, OH

The creosote accumulation level is the primary driver in Ashville. Annual cleaning stays at stage one accumulation and takes less time than a chimney that has not been swept in several years in Ashville, OH. Chimney height affects sweep time. Multiple flues cost more because each is swept separately in Ashville.

Why Regular Sweeping Saves You Money Long-Term in Ashville, OH

A chimney swept annually stays at stage one creosote accumulation that is quick and inexpensive to remove in Ashville. A chimney left for multiple seasons may reach stage two or stage three accumulation that requires chemical treatment and additional equipment, costing significantly more in Ashville, OH. And a chimney fire from ignited creosote can require full liner replacement at $2,000 to $5,000 or more, not counting structural damage in Ashville, OH in Ashville. The annual sweep cost is a fraction of either outcome in Ashville, OH.
